CocoaLumberjack是一个流行的日志记录框架,用于在iOS和Mac应用程序中记录和管理日志信息。它提供了强大的日志记录功能,可以帮助开发人员更好地调试和分析应用程序的运行情况。
要在Xcode中查看CocoaLumberjack生成的日志文件数据,可以按照以下步骤进行操作:
- 首先,确保已经在项目中集成了CocoaLumberjack框架,并在代码中进行了相应的配置和日志记录。
- 打开Xcode,并选择你的项目。
- 在Xcode的顶部菜单栏中,选择"Product",然后选择"Scheme",再选择"Edit Scheme"。
- 在弹出的窗口中,选择"Run"选项卡。
- 在左侧的列表中,选择"Arguments"选项。
- 在"Arguments Passed On Launch"部分,点击"+"按钮添加一个新的参数。
- 在新添加的参数中,输入"OS_ACTIVITY_MODE"作为名称,输入"value"作为值。
- 确保"OS_ACTIVITY_MODE"参数的值设置为"disable",这将禁用Xcode的默认日志输出。
- 点击"Close"按钮关闭Scheme编辑窗口。
- 现在,当你运行应用程序时,CocoaLumberjack将会将日志信息写入到文件中。
- 要查看日志文件数据,可以在Finder中导航到应用程序的沙盒目录。沙盒目录的路径通常是:~/Library/Developer/CoreSimulator/Devices/{设备ID}/data/Containers/Data/Application/{应用程序ID}/Documents/。
- 在Documents目录中,你将找到CocoaLumberjack生成的日志文件。你可以使用文本编辑器或其他日志查看工具打开这些文件,以查看其中的日志数据。
总结起来,使用CocoaLumberjack在Xcode中查看日志文件数据的步骤如下:
- 集成CocoaLumberjack框架并进行配置。
- 在Xcode的Scheme设置中禁用默认日志输出。
- 运行应用程序并导航到沙盒目录中的日志文件。
推荐的腾讯云相关产品:腾讯云日志服务(CLS)。腾讯云日志服务(Cloud Log Service,CLS)是一种全托管的日志管理服务,可帮助用户实时采集、存储、检索和分析大规模日志数据。CLS提供了强大的日志查询和分析功能,可以帮助用户更好地理解和优化应用程序的运行情况。
腾讯云日志服务产品介绍链接地址:https://cloud.tencent.com/product/cls